在当今高度互联的数字世界中,企业与个人用户对网络安全性、灵活性和远程访问能力的需求日益增长,虚拟专用网络(VPN)作为一种加密隧道技术,能够有效保障数据传输的安全性,尤其适用于远程办公、分支机构互联以及跨地域业务部署等场景,作为网络工程师,本文将详细阐述如何基于路由器设备搭建一个稳定、安全的路由级VPN服务,帮助你从零开始构建私有网络通信环境。
明确目标:我们希望在家庭或小型办公室网络环境中,通过一台支持VPN功能的路由器(如OpenWRT、DD-WRT或商业品牌如华硕、TP-Link等),为远程用户提供加密访问内网资源的能力,这不仅限于访问文件共享、打印机或监控系统,还能扩展至访问内部Web应用或数据库。
第一步是选择合适的路由器硬件与固件,若使用开源固件如OpenWRT,它提供了强大的自定义能力和丰富的插件支持,包括OpenVPN、WireGuard等主流协议,确保路由器具备足够的CPU性能和内存(建议至少512MB RAM),以应对并发连接需求。
第二步是配置基础网络参数,登录路由器管理界面后,设置静态IP地址(如192.168.1.1),并确保DHCP服务正常运行,为未来分配给VPN客户端的IP池预留子网,例如10.8.0.0/24,这样可以避免与局域网冲突。
第三步是安装和配置OpenVPN服务器(或WireGuard,后者更轻量高效),以OpenVPN为例,需生成证书和密钥(使用Easy-RSA工具),创建服务器配置文件(server.conf),指定加密算法(推荐AES-256)、TLS认证方式(如TLS 1.2以上)及端口(默认UDP 1194),特别注意启用“push route”指令,使客户端能自动访问内网资源。
第四步是配置防火墙规则,在路由器上添加iptables规则,允许来自VPN接口的流量转发,并启用NAT(网络地址转换)让客户端访问外网,添加如下规则:
iptables -A FORWARD -i tun0 -o eth0 -j ACCEPT iptables -A FORWARD -i eth0 -o tun0 -m state --state RELATED,ESTABLISHED -j ACCEPT
在路由器的Web界面中开启“IP转发”选项。
第五步是分发客户端配置文件,为每个用户生成唯一的证书和配置文件(包含服务器地址、端口、加密参数),通过安全渠道(如加密邮件或USB存储)发送,Windows、Mac、Linux和移动平台均支持OpenVPN客户端,安装后即可一键连接。
测试与优化,连接成功后,验证是否可访问内网资源(如ping 192.168.1.100),检查日志是否有错误信息,定期更新证书有效期,启用日志轮转,防止磁盘占用过高,考虑部署动态DNS服务(如No-IP)以便公网访问,避免IP变化导致连接中断。
基于路由器搭建路由级VPN是一项兼具实用价值与技术深度的工作,它不仅提升了网络边界的安全防护能力,也为远程协作提供了坚实基础,对于网络工程师来说,掌握这一技能意味着能在复杂网络环境中灵活应对各种挑战,为企业数字化转型保驾护航。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速


